Operations CXO Status ReportMonday 4/24/00 9:30 EDTDuring the last week, Chandra completed the observing schedule as planned. A new version of the Off-Line System (OFLS release 8.1A) was installed on the operational strings on 4/19 following completion of acceptance testing at the OCC. The release provides several enhancements and a number of fixes including allowing target offsets for roll constrained observations and correctly calculating the LGA visibility with allowance for Sun shade door blockage. The new release was used to build the schedule and command loads for the week of April 23. The planned observations for next week are as follows.
